Why Private Wealth Management Has Become Essential for Modern Life Planning

Financial planning has changed significantly over the years. In the past, many people viewed wealth management as a service focused mainly on investing and portfolio performance. Today, the role of private wealth management extends much further. Individuals and families now seek financial strategies that support every stage of life, from building wealth and preparing for retirement to protecting loved ones and creating a lasting legacy. Private wealth management has become an important part of life planning because financial decisions affect nearly every personal milestone. Buying a home, funding education, starting a business, caring for aging parents, and planning retirement all require thoughtful preparation. By combining investment management with comprehensive financial guidance, wealth managers help clients make confident decisions that align with both their financial goals and personal values. Why Private Wealth Management Is Shifting From Financial Goals to Life Goals

Private wealth management is undergoing a quiet but powerful transformation. For decades, success was measured mainly through portfolio performance, net worth growth, and investment returns. Today, that definition is expanding. High-net-worth individuals and families are increasingly asking a deeper question: what is the purpose of this wealth beyond numbers? This shift reflects a broader change in mindset. Wealth is no longer viewed only as an outcome of financial discipline but as a tool to support a meaningful and well-balanced life. As a result, private wealth management is evolving into a more holistic approach, in which financial planning connects directly with personal values, lifestyle choices, and long-term aspirations. The New Standard of Wealth Guidance for Families With Complex Lives

 The relationship between affluent families and their advisors has changed dramatically in recent years. Investment management remains important, but it is no longer the primary reason many wealthy families seek professional guidance. Today, they are looking for advisors who can help navigate business ownership, family transitions, charitable goals, and long-term legacy planning. This broader role has given rise to executive wealth partnership , where the advisor serves as a trusted resource across many areas of a family's financial life. As wealth becomes more sophisticated, expectations naturally evolve. Families want insight that reflects their unique circumstances, not generic recommendations that could apply to anyone. The strongest relationships are built on understanding the whole picture rather than focusing on a single aspect of financial management.
